High-dose Rifampicin for the Treatment of Tuberculous Meningitis: a Dose-finding Study
Tuberculosis, MeningealUnlock trial analytics

Study Endpoints

Primary Endpoints

Rifampicin concentrations in plasma and cerebrospinal fluid (CSF)
Day 2 (+/- 1) after administration of study drugs

The rifampicin concentrations in plasma are measured from blood samples that are obtained by intensive pharmacokinetic sampling at 6 sampling time points (h0, 1, 2, 4, 8, 12 post dose). CSF rifampicin concentration will be measured using CSF sample taken by means of lumbar puncture at hour 3-6 post dose at the same day of blood sampling.

Secondary Endpoints

Rifampicin concentrations in plasma and CSF at steady-state
Day 10 (+/- 1) after starting treatment with study drugs
Grade 3 and 4 and serious adverse events
Within 60 days
Mortality
180 days

Study Design & Arms

AllocationRANDOMIZED
MaskingQUADRUPLE
ModelPARALLEL
PurposeTREATMENT

Treatment Arms

ArmTypeDescription
Rifampicin 450 mg (standard dose)ACTIVE_COMPARATORTwenty patients will receive 1 tablet of 450 mg Rifampicin and 2 tablets of placebo once daily for 30 days. Unconscious subjects will receive oral drugs via nasogastric tubes (NGT). After completion of one-month treatment, patients will receive 1 tablet of 450 mg Rifampicin. Along with study drug and placebo, patients will receive other oral TB drugs (INH, Ethambutol, and Pyrazinamide) and pyridoxin, in accordance to National TB Program guidelines for 6 months. Patients will also receive dexamethasone in decreasing dose (in 6-8 weeks, according to TBM severity grade on admission)
Rifampicin 900 mg per oralEXPERIMENTALTwenty patients will receive 2 tablets of 450 mg Rifampicin and 1 tablet of placebo once daily for 30 days. Unconscious subjects will receive oral drugs via nasogastric tubes (NGT) After completion of one-month treatment, patients will receive 1 tablet of 450 mg Rifampicin. Along with study drug and placebo, patients will receive other oral TB drugs (INH, Ethambutol, and Pyrazinamide) and pyridoxin, in accordance to National TB Program guidelines for 6 months. Patients will also receive dexamethasone in decreasing dose (in 6-8 weeks, according to TBM severity grade on admission)
Rifampicin 1350 mg per oralEXPERIMENTALTwenty patients will receive 3 tablets of 450 mg Rifampicin and 0 tablet of placebo once daily for 30 days. Unconscious subjects will receive oral drugs via nasogastric tubes (NGT) After completion of one-month treatment, patients will receive 1 tablet of 450 mg Rifampicin. Along with study drug and placebo, patients will receive other oral TB drugs (INH, Ethambutol, and Pyrazinamide) and pyridoxin, in accordance to National TB Program guidelines for 6 months. Patients will also receive dexamethasone in decreasing dose (in 6-8 weeks, according to TBM severity grade on admission)

Interventions

NameTypeDescription
PlaceboDRUGPatients receiving 450 mg rifampicin will receive additional 2 placebo tablets, while those who receive 900 mg rifampicin will receive 1 placebo tablet. Patients receiving 1350 mg rifampicin will not receive any placebo tablet. With this arrangement, every subject will receive 3 tablets of study drugs.
RifampicinDRUGPatients in experimental arms will receive either 1 or 2 additional tablets of rifampicin. Placebo tablets will be added accordingly, so that every study subject will receive 3 tablets of rifampicin plus placebo as described in the Arms section.
Other TB drugsDRUGAlong with study drug and placebo, patients will receive other oral TB drugs (INH, Ethambutol, and Pyrazinamide) and pyridoxin, in accordance to National TB Program guidelines for 6 months. Unconscious subjects will receive oral drugs via nasogastric tubes (NGT)
Adjuvant dexamethasoneDRUGPatients will receive dexamethasone in decreasing dose (in 6-8 weeks, according to TBM severity grade on admission)

Frequently asked questions about Rifampicin

What is Rifampicin used for in Tuberculosis, Meningeal?

Rifampicin is being studied for the treatment of Tuberculosis, Meningeal, a form of tuberculosis that affects the membranes surrounding the brain and spinal cord. It is a small molecule antibiotic being evaluated in a Phase 2 clinical trial to determine the appropriate dosing for this condition.

What clinical trials is Rifampicin in?

Rifampicin has been studied in one completed Phase 2 clinical trial with the identifier NCT02169882. The trial, titled 'High-dose Rifampicin for the Treatment of Tuberculous Meningitis: a Dose-finding Study,' enrolled 60 participants in Indonesia and was designed to evaluate dosing for the treatment of Tuberculosis, Meningeal.
